Output e9704cebb630418df31fcf45b040be26daf55f9417c08b51484685a46943c06a:0

value
6934928026552
script pubkey
OP_0 OP_PUSHBYTES_20 b250e666801c225d0c8ea71385b40fec8738d837
address
tb1qkfgwve5qrs396ryw5ufctdq0ajrn3kph428puc
transaction
e9704cebb630418df31fcf45b040be26daf55f9417c08b51484685a46943c06a
confirmations
183613
spent
true